Organizing principles for single-joint movements. II. A speed-sensitive strategy.

D M Corcos1, G L Gottlieb, G C Agarwal

  • 1Department of Physical Education, University of Illinois, Chicago 60680.

Summary

Human movement control involves adjusting muscle activation rates to regulate joint torque and speed. This study reveals two distinct muscle activation strategies influencing movement dynamics and kinematics.
